The regulations around service pets and assistance animals can occasionally feel tough to navigate. There has actually been a growing trend of lessees requiring friend animals, which are most typically emotional assistance animals.
Recent laws call for that any qualified medical professional that supplies documents concerning a person's requirement for a psychological support animal should have a recognized relationship with their patient. Property Management Services. That partnership has to have been established for at the very least 30 days in order for the paperwork to be approved. The physician should additionally finish an in-person medical evaluation of the person who demands the emotional assistance animal

Home supervisors should include lawfully called for disclosures regarding: Lead-based paint (for pre-1978 buildings)Recognized mold and mildew or environmental hazardsShared energy arrangementsPest control treatmentsMilitary ordnance places (if suitable)Supervisors must likewise record upkeep obligations and entry notice needs. California regulation requires 24-hour written notice prior to getting in busy systems other than in emergency situations. Down payment limitations in California depend upon whether the service is furnished or bare.
Residential or commercial property supervisors in California need to adhere to particular legislations and guidelines to run lawfully and avoid charges. Correct licensing and authorization needs go together with maintaining wellness and safety and security requirements for all rental residential properties. Residential or commercial property managers have to obtain a genuine estate broker license or work under a qualified broker to lawfully operate.

Many communities call for: Organization licenseTax enrollment certificateFictitious company name declaring (if appropriate)Company Recognition Number (EIN)Building supervisors handling depend on accounts need to adhere to rigorous policies for handling client funds. For multi-unit buildings, extra authorizations might be needed for: Fire safety Read More Here inspectionsElevator maintenancePool maintenancePest control solutions Home managers need to keep rental residential or commercial properties that meet The golden state's indicated guarantee of habitability requirements.
Weekend entries ought to be restricted unless the occupant agrees or else. Taking photographs inside occupied systems calls for tenant consent unless documenting damages or infractions. Security cams in usual areas are allowed, however not in personal spaces. Occupants can demand invasion of personal privacy if these civil liberties are broken. Building managers have to adhere to strict California expulsion refines to legally remove occupants.
The reaction must match the intensity of the infraction. For minor violations: File the concern with images or created recordsIssue a created notification defining the violationProvide affordable time for adjustment (usually 3-30 days)For significant infractions like non-payment of rent, property managers should offer a 3-day notification to pay or quit prior to continuing with eviction.
